Is it okay to have a weld skirt after a hydrostatic test?

2015-12-14View Original

Thread Content

Today, I went to the container factory to inspect the equipment and noticed a problem: we have a tower-type vessel with a skirt structure. The transition section cylinders in the skirt have already been welded to the lower head; what remains is only the lower part of the skirt cylinders and the base ring (which has already been prefabricated as a single unit). This portion has not been welded to the transition section of the vessel’s skirt or to the parts above it. According to the technical specifications, this portion does not require heat treatment. Yet the manufacturer still carried out a horizontal hydrostatic test on the equipment. Is it acceptable to do this? The manufacturer said there are other products as well; considering factors such as the site and equipment, a hydrostatic test was carried out first. The drawings also permit horizontal hydrostatic testing, and the parts that have not been welded are non-pressure components, so it has no impact on the tower, and there is no problem with doing this. I would like to ask if this approach is appropriate? Is it a violation of regulations or standards?

No problem; in some designs, it is not desired for the skirt cylinder to undergo heat treatment, so it is proposed to weld the skirt cylinder to the transition section after heat treatment. It doesn’t matter whether the pressure test is carried out on a vessel with a skirt or without one; after all, the testing is not done in an upright position. It is sufficient to ensure the tolerances during the assembly of the skirt cylinder and the transition section.

The connection welds between non-compressed components and pressure vessels are considered part of the pressure vessel itself. So the skirt base mentioned by the original poster should not be governed by the code. The manufacturer should not have violated the tolerance specifications.

Yes, a hydrostatic test is used to verify strength and sealing performance; whether or not a skirt is welded has no impact on the strength and sealing performance of the container shell

Even for equipment that requires heat treatment, there is no problem; a transition section has already been welded in for heat treatment, and it is more reasonable to weld the lower skirt portion after the heat treatment.
